Job Statements…
• Define the functional and emotional tasks, goals and activities that people want to
accomplish
• Define the action for which a product or service may be needed
• Can be captured for any demographic and around any situation or context
• Are the key to discovering opportunities for new or expanded markets, e.g.,
uncontested market space, etc.
• Although they are stable over time, additional jobs are always possible
